🚀 A Journey of Growth at SECO
At SECO, we believe that people grow best when they’re trusted, supported, and empowered. That’s exactly what happened to Christian Koch, who joined SECO’s Wuppertal office in 2021 as a student trainee in production — and is now ready to take the next big step in his professional journey.
After balancing his studies with hands-on work experience for the past few years, Christian will officially start a new chapter on September 1, stepping into the role of Junior Simulation and Validation Engineer in the R&D team, right after completing his master’s degree in Electrical Engineering.
🌱 More Than a Job: Learning by Doing
“Working as a student trainee while studying was a challenge,” Christian shares, “but it also gave me the chance to grow, apply what I was learning, and gain real experience.”
This blend of theory and practice not only helped him develop technical skills, but also gave him a stronger sense of direction and purpose. His transition to a full-time engineering role is the natural evolution of a journey built on dedication, learning, and trust — values that are at the core of SECO’s approach to people development.
